Direct Bookings vs. OTAs: Finding the Perfect Balance in 2026


The year 2026 finds the hospitality industry in a state of full digital maturity. While demand remains strong, competition has become increasingly complex. Today’s travelers aren’t just looking for a room; they are searching for the best overall value, comparing dozens of sources before making that final click.
According to the latest data from ELSTAT, tourist arrivals and revenues continue their upward trajectory, confirming that Greece remains a top-tier global destination. However, digital penetration has now hit its peak. Any property that lacks a strong, autonomous online presence risks being left behind.
The shift toward direct bookings is no longer just a “cost-saving” tactic; it is a survival strategy.
Despite the rise of direct bookings, OTAs (Booking.com, Expedia, etc.) remain vital. Their massive advertising power and dominance in search results make them the ideal “digital storefront” for acquiring new customers. They serve as a safety net, ensuring occupancy even during periods of low demand.
The key for 2026 is not to reject OTAs, but to leverage the “Billboard Effect”: The guest finds you there, but completes the reservation with you.
